Am 26.09.2018 um 18:43 schrieb Thomas Hellstrom:
> On 09/26/2018 06:35 PM, Christian König wrote:
>> Am 26.09.2018 um 18:18 schrieb Thomas Hellstrom:
>>> Export ttm_bo_reference_unless_doomed() to be used when looking up 
>>> buffer
>>> objects that are removed from the lookup structure in the destructor.
>>>
>>> Cc: Christian König <christian.koenig at amd.com>
>>> Signed-off-by: Thomas Hellstrom <thellstrom at vmware.com>
>>> Reviewed-by: Sinclair Yeh <syeh at vmware.com>
>>> ---
>>>   drivers/gpu/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_vm.c |  3 +--
>>>   include/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_api.h    | 18 ++++++++++++++++++
>>>   2 files changed, 19 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
>>>
>>> di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_vm.c 
>>> b/drivers/gpu/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_vm.c
>>> index 6fe91c1b692d..ec4b09366213 100644
>>> --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_vm.c
>>> +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_vm.c
>>> @@ -409,8 +409,7 @@ static struct ttm_buffer_object 
>>> *ttm_bo_vm_lookup(struct ttm_bo_device *bdev,
>>>       node = drm_vma_offset_lookup_locked(&bdev->vma_manager, 
>>> offset, pages);
>>>       if (likely(node)) {
>>>           bo = container_of(node, struct ttm_buffer_object, vma_node);
>>> -        if (!kref_get_unless_zero(&bo->kref))
>>> -            bo = NULL;
>>> +        bo = ttm_bo_reference_unless_doomed(bo);
>>>       }
>>> drm_vma_offset_unlock_lookup(&bdev->vma_manager);
>>> diff --git a/include/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_api.h 
>>> b/include/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_api.h
>>> index 8c19470785e2..b6bf6b086576 100644
>>> --- a/include/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_api.h
>>> +++ b/include/drm/ttm/ttm_bo_api.h
>>> @@ -312,6 +312,24 @@ ttm_bo_reference(struct ttm_buffer_object *bo)
>>>       return bo;
>>>   }
>>>   +/**
>>> + * ttm_bo_reference_unless_doomed - reference a struct 
>>> ttm_buffer_object unless
>>> + * its refcount has already reached zero.
>>> + * @bo: The buffer object.
>>> + *
>>> + * Used to reference a TTM buffer object in lookups where the 
>>> object is removed
>>> + * from the lookup structure during the destructor and for RCU 
>>> lookups.
>>> + *
>>> + * Returns: @bo if the referencing was successful, NULL otherwise.
>>> + */
>>> +static inline __must_check struct ttm_buffer_object *
>>> +ttm_bo_reference_unless_doomed(struct ttm_buffer_object *bo)
>>
>> Please name that ttm_bo_get_rcu(), we are in the process of renaming 
>> ttm_bo_reference into ttm_bo_get as well.
>
> Could we call it ttm_bo_get_unless_doomed() or 
> ttm_bo_get_unless_zero() to be even more consistent. (It's not 
> restricted to rcu as the VM usage shows). Also "doomed" is more 
> relevant for objects, "zero" is more relevant for the refcount itself?

ttm_bo_get_unless_zero() is fine with me as well.

Christian.
